Tensions within the Beckham family appear to have escalated to a legal dimension, with Brooklyn Beckham reportedly cutting off direct communication with his famous parents, David and Victoria Beckham. According to sources, Brooklyn has instructed that all communication must now occur solely through legal representatives.

The rift, which has been simmering for years, reportedly began over disagreements related to Brooklyn’s wife Nicola Peltz, including her wedding dress in 2022, and later intensified due to social media interactions and family dynamics involving his siblings. Brooklyn has also distanced himself from other immediate family members, signaling a sharp escalation in the ongoing dispute.
A source told The Sun that Brooklyn’s decision was meant as a private measure to try and resolve issues discreetly, rather than a direct legal threat. “He issued a letter via lawyers at the end of last summer, asking that any correspondence be routed legally. He wanted to make amends privately, not publicly,” the source explained.
Amid the family feud, Brooklyn publicly celebrated his wife Nicola Peltz’s birthday on social media, sharing a heartfelt message praising her personality and work ethic, without any mention of his parents or the conflict.
Brooklyn and Nicola married on April 9, 2022, and renewed their vows in August 2025. The Beckhams were notably absent from the vow renewal, highlighting the growing distance between Brooklyn and his family.
No official statements have been made by Brooklyn or the Beckham family regarding the legal communication reports.
